使用npm 的时候出现如下问题:
FATAL ERROR: Ineffective mark-compacts near heap limit Allocation failed - JavaScript heap out of memory
1: 00007FF6A6B0076F napi_wrap+124431
2: 00007FF6A6AA24B6 v8::base::CPU::has_sse+34502
3: 00007FF6A6AA3176 v8::base::CPU::has_sse+37766
4: 00007FF6A72A6D3E v8::Isolate::ReportExternalAllocationLimitReached+94
5: 00007FF6A728ED81 v8::SharedArrayBuffer::Externalize+833
6: 00007FF6A715C64C v8::internal::Heap::EphemeronKeyWriteBarrierFromCode+1436
7: 00007FF6A71679F0 v8::internal::Heap::ProtectUnprotectedMemoryChunks+1312
8: 00007FF6A7164524 v8::internal::Heap::PageFlagsAreConsistent+3204
9: 00007FF6A7159DB3 v8::internal::Heap::CollectGarbage+1283
10: 00007FF6A715C79A v8::internal::Heap::EphemeronKeyWriteBarrierFromCode+1770
11: 00007FF6A7152E43 v8::base::CPU::has_vfp3+467
12: 00007FF6A6A4E5AC v8::internal::wasm::SignatureMap::Freeze+120700
13: 00007FF6A6A4D550 v8::internal::wasm::SignatureMap::Freeze+116512
14: 00007FF6A6B4989B uv_async_send+331
15: 00007FF6A6B4903C uv_loop_init+1212
16: 00007FF6A6B49204 uv_run+244
17: 00007FF6A6A6B6B2 EVP_CIPHER_CTX_buf_noconst+30866
18: 00007FF6A6AC9083 node::Start+275
19: 00007FF6A698664C RC4_options+339276
20: 00007FF6A7785B48 v8::internal::SetupIsolateDelegate::SetupHeap+1301368
21: 00007FFEB1607974 BaseThreadInitThunk+20
22: 00007FFEB353A271 RtlUserThreadStart+33
解决方案:
删除:C:\Users\用户.npmrc 文件